PXRMDEV ;SLC/PKR - This is a driver for testing Clinical Reminders. ;06/23/2020
Source file <PXRMDEV.m>
Package | Total | Call Graph |
---|---|---|
Clinical Reminders | 7 | EVAL^PXRM $$ASKYN^PXRMEUT (FMTOUT,MHVCOUT,MHVOUT)^PXRMFMTO (DEF,TERM)^PXRMLDR IEVALTER^PXRMTERM FORMATS^PXRMTEXT ($$BORP,ACOPY,AWRITE,GPRINT)^PXRMUTIL |
Kernel | 4 | (ENDR,KILL)^%ZISS ($$DT,$$FMTE,$$HDIFF)^XLFDT ($$CPUTIME,$$ETIMEMS)^XLFSHAN $$RJ^XLFSTR |
VA FileMan | 4 | BROWSE^DDBR ^DIC $$GET1^DIQ ^DIR |
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
Clinical Reminders | 2 | PXRM REMINDER TEST PXRM TERM TESTER |
Name | Comments | DBIA/ICR reference |
---|---|---|
DEB | ;Prompt for patient and reminder by name input component.
|
|
GPAT1 | ||
GREM1 | ||
DEV | ;Prompt for patient and reminder by name and evaluation date.
|
|
GPAT2 | ||
GREM2 | ||
DISP01(FIEVAL) | ;For Education Topics, Exams, and Health Factors the Print Name
|
|
DOREM(DFN,PXRMITEM,PXRHM,DATE) | ;Do the reminder
|
|
TERM | ;
|
|
TPAT | ||
TTERM |
Name | Field # of Occurrence |
---|---|
ENDR^%ZISS | DOREM+134 |
KILL^%ZISS | DOREM+137 |
BROWSE^DDBR | DOREM+135 |
^DIC | GPAT1, GREM1, GPAT2, GREM2, TPAT, TTERM |
$$GET1^DIQ | DOREM+21 |
^DIR | GREM1+7, GREM1+17, GREM2+11 |
EVAL^PXRM | DOREM+10, DOREM+11 |
$$ASKYN^PXRMEUT | GREM1+23, GREM1+29, GREM2+17, GREM2+23 |
FMTOUT^PXRMFMTO | DOREM+116 |
MHVCOUT^PXRMFMTO | DOREM+129 |
MHVOUT^PXRMFMTO | DOREM+125 |
DEF^PXRMLDR | DOREM+9 |
TERM^PXRMLDR | TTERM+5 |
IEVALTER^PXRMTERM | TTERM+12 |
FORMATS^PXRMTEXT | DOREM+37, DOREM+48 |
$$BORP^PXRMUTIL | DOREM+131 |
ACOPY^PXRMUTIL | DOREM+33, DOREM+67, DOREM+77, DOREM+98, DOREM+108 |
AWRITE^PXRMUTIL | TTERM+16 |
GPRINT^PXRMUTIL | DOREM+138 |
$$DT^XLFDT | GREM1+14, GREM2+8 |
$$FMTE^XLFDT | GREM1+14, GREM2+8, DOREM+89 |
$$HDIFF^XLFDT | DOREM+23 |
$$CPUTIME^XLFSHAN | DOREM+8, DOREM+12 |
$$ETIMEMS^XLFSHAN | DOREM+22 |
$$RJ^XLFSTR | DOREM+55 |
Name | Line Occurrences |
---|---|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Function Call: WRITE |
|
Routine Call |
|
Routine Call |
|
FileNo | Call Tags |
---|---|
^DPT - [#2] | GET1^DIQ |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^AUTTEDT - [#9999999.09] | DISP01+9 |
^AUTTEXAM - [#9999999.15] | DISP01+10 |
^AUTTHF - [#9999999.64] | DISP01+11 |
^PXD(811.9 - [#811.9] | GREM1+22, GREM1+24, GREM1+27, GREM1+28, GREM2+16, GREM2+18, GREM2+21, GREM2+22, DOREM+17 |
^TMP( | DOREM+15!, DOREM+93, DOREM+101! |
^TMP("PXRHM" | DOREM+103, DOREM+120, DOREM+121, DOREM+122, DOREM+124, DOREM+130! |
^TMP("PXRM" | DOREM+130! |
^TMP("PXRMDEM" | DOREM+87, DOREM+88, DOREM+91! |
^TMP("PXRMELIG" | DOREM+73, DOREM+75, DOREM+76! |
^TMP("PXRMFFSS" | DOREM+51, DOREM+54, DOREM+55, DOREM+56! |
^TMP("PXRMMHV" | DOREM+124*, DOREM+130! |
^TMP("PXRMMHVC" | DOREM+130! |
^TMP("PXRMTDEB" | DOREM+63, DOREM+64, DOREM+70! |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
BOP | DOREM+2~, DOREM+131*, DOREM+132, DOREM+138 |
DATE | DEB+1~, GREM1+20*, GREM1+30, DEV+1~, GREM2+14*, GREM2+24, DOREM~, DOREM+10, DOREM+11 |
DEFARR | DOREM+2~, DOREM+9, DOREM+10, DOREM+11 |
DFN | DEB+1~, GPAT1+3*, GPAT1+4, GREM1+30, DEV+1~, GPAT2+3*, GPAT2+4, GREM2+24, DOREM~, DOREM+10 , DOREM+11, DOREM+21, TERM+1~, TPAT+3*, TPAT+4, TTERM+12 |
DIC | DEB+1~, DEB+3*, GPAT1+5*, DEV+1~, DEV+3*, GPAT2+5*, TERM+1~, TERM+3*, TPAT+5* |
DIC("A" | DEB+3*, GPAT1+5*, DEV+3*, GPAT2+5*, TERM+3*, TPAT+5* |
DIC(0 | DEB+4*, DEV+4*, TERM+4* |
DIR | DEB+1~, GREM1+17!, GREM2+11! |
DIR("A" | GREM1+6*, GREM1+13*, GREM2+7* |
DIR("B" | GREM1+14*, GREM2+8* |
DIR("PRE" | GREM1+15*, GREM2+9* |
DIR(0 | GREM1+5*, GREM1+12*, GREM2+6* |
DIROUT | DEB+1~, GPAT1+1, GREM1+1, GREM1+8, GREM1+18, DEV+1~, GPAT2+1, GREM2+1, GREM2+12, TERM+1~ , TPAT+1, TTERM+1 |
DIRUT | GPAT1+1, GREM1+1, GREM1+8, GREM1+18, DEV+1~, GPAT2+1, GREM2+1, GREM2+12, TERM+1~, TPAT+1 , TTERM+1 |
DTOUT | DEB+1~, GPAT1+2, GREM1+2, GREM1+9, GREM1+19, DEV+1~, GPAT2+2, GREM2+2, GREM2+13, TERM+1~ , TPAT+2, TTERM+2 |
DUOUT | DEB+1~, GPAT1+2, GREM1+2, GREM1+9, GREM1+19, DEV+1~, GPAT2+2, GREM2+2, GREM2+13, TERM+1~ , TPAT+2, TTERM+2 |
END | DOREM+2~, DOREM+12*, DOREM+22 |
FFN | DOREM+2~, DOREM+26*, DOREM+27*, DOREM+28, DOREM+29, DOREM+30, DOREM+41~, DOREM+49*, DOREM+51, DOREM+54 , DOREM+55 |
FFNUMBER | DOREM+2~, DOREM+28*, DOREM+29, DOREM+44*, DOREM+45*, DOREM+47, DOREM+48, DOREM+49 |
FIEVAL | DISP01~, DOREM+2~, DOREM+10, DOREM+11, DOREM+15*, DOREM+31, TERM+2~, TTERM+12, TTERM+13 |
FIEVAL( | DISP01+6, DISP01+7, DISP01+8, DISP01+9*, DISP01+10*, DISP01+11*, DOREM+27, DOREM+29, DOREM+30! |
FIEVAL("FF" | DOREM+29*, DOREM+45, DOREM+47, DOREM+48 |
FIEVAL(1 | TTERM+14 |
FINDING | DOREM+2~, DOREM+62*, DOREM+63*, DOREM+64, DOREM+65 |
FINDPA | TERM+2~, TTERM+12 |
FINDPA(0 | TTERM+11* |
HASFF | DEB+1~, GREM1+21*, GREM1+22*, GREM1+23, DEV+1~, GREM2+15*, GREM2+16*, GREM2+17 |
HASTERM | DEB+1~, GREM1+21*, GREM1+24*, GREM1+25, GREM1+28*, GREM1+29, DEV+1~, GREM2+15*, GREM2+18*, GREM2+19 , GREM2+22*, GREM2+23 |
IEN | DISP01+4~, DISP01+8*, DISP01+9, DISP01+10, DISP01+11 |
IND | DEB+1~, GREM1+26*, GREM1+27*, GREM1+28, DEV+1~, GREM2+20*, GREM2+21*, GREM2+22, DISP01+4~, DISP01+5* , DISP01+6*, DISP01+7, DISP01+8, DISP01+9, DISP01+10, DISP01+11, DOREM+2~, DOREM+34*, DOREM+35*, DOREM+36 , DOREM+37, DOREM+68*, DOREM+69*, DOREM+80*, DOREM+81*, DOREM+86*, DOREM+87*, DOREM+88, DOREM+89, DOREM+90 , DOREM+99*, DOREM+100*, DOREM+109*, DOREM+110*, TERM+2~, TTERM+6*, TTERM+7*, TTERM+8, TTERM+9 |
>> IORESET | DOREM+136 |
JND | DOREM+2~, DOREM+38*, DOREM+50* |
MAXOCC | TERM+2~, TTERM+6*, TTERM+8*, TTERM+10*, TTERM+11 |
NL | DOREM+2~, DOREM+6*, DOREM+20*, DOREM+21*, DOREM+22*, DOREM+23*, DOREM+24*, DOREM+25*, DOREM+36*, DOREM+38* , DOREM+42*, DOREM+43*, DOREM+46*, DOREM+47*, DOREM+50*, DOREM+51*, DOREM+52*, DOREM+55*, DOREM+59*, DOREM+60* , DOREM+65*, DOREM+69*, DOREM+78*, DOREM+79*, DOREM+81*, DOREM+84*, DOREM+85*, DOREM+90*, DOREM+94*, DOREM+95* , DOREM+100*, DOREM+104*, DOREM+105*, DOREM+110*, DOREM+114*, DOREM+115*, DOREM+116, DOREM+118*, DOREM+119*, DOREM+125 , DOREM+127*, DOREM+128*, DOREM+129 |
NOUT | DOREM+2~, DOREM+37, DOREM+38, DOREM+48, DOREM+50 |
OCC | TERM+2~, TTERM+9*, TTERM+10 |
OUTPUT | DOREM+2~, DOREM+116, DOREM+125, DOREM+129 |
OUTPUT( | DOREM+20*, DOREM+21*, DOREM+22*, DOREM+23*, DOREM+24*, DOREM+25*, DOREM+36*, DOREM+38*, DOREM+42*, DOREM+43* , DOREM+46*, DOREM+47*, DOREM+50*, DOREM+51*, DOREM+52*, DOREM+55*, DOREM+59*, DOREM+60*, DOREM+65*, DOREM+69* , DOREM+78*, DOREM+79*, DOREM+81*, DOREM+84*, DOREM+85*, DOREM+90*, DOREM+94*, DOREM+95*, DOREM+100*, DOREM+104* , DOREM+105*, DOREM+110*, DOREM+114*, DOREM+115*, DOREM+118*, DOREM+119*, DOREM+127*, DOREM+128* |
PNAME | DOREM+3~, DOREM+18*, DOREM+19*, DOREM+20 |
PXRHM | DEB+2~, GREM1+11*, GREM1+30, DEV+2~, GREM2+5*, GREM2+24, DOREM~, DOREM+10, DOREM+11, DOREM+112 , DOREM+113, DOREM+117, DOREM+119, DOREM+126 |
PXRMDEBG | DOREM+3~, DOREM+6* |
PXRMFFSS | DEB+2~, GREM1+21*, GREM1+23*, DEV+2~, GREM2+15*, GREM2+17*, DOREM+40 |
PXRMID | DOREM+3~, DOREM+15, DOREM+93, DOREM+101 |
PXRMITEM | DEB+2~, GREM1+3*, GREM1+4, GREM1+22, GREM1+24, GREM1+27, GREM1+28, GREM1+30, DEV+2~, GREM2+3* , GREM2+4, GREM2+16, GREM2+18, GREM2+21, GREM2+22, GREM2+24, DOREM~, DOREM+9, DOREM+17 |
PXRMTDEB | DEB+2~, GREM1+21*, GREM1+29*, DEV+2~, GREM2+15*, GREM2+23*, DOREM+58 |
REF | DEV+2~, DOREM+3~, DOREM+32*, DOREM+33, DOREM+61*, DOREM+67, DOREM+96*, DOREM+98, DOREM+106*, DOREM+108 |
RIEN | DOREM+3~, DOREM+120*, DOREM+121, DOREM+122, DOREM+124, DOREM+125 |
RNAME | DOREM+3~, DOREM+121*, DOREM+122, DOREM+124, DOREM+125 |
START | DOREM+3~, DOREM+8*, DOREM+22 |
STATUS | DOREM+3~, DOREM+122*, DOREM+123*, DOREM+124, DOREM+125 |
STEP | DOREM+41~, DOREM+53*, DOREM+54*, DOREM+55 |
TERMARR | TERM+2~, TTERM+5, TTERM+12 |
TERMARR(20 | TTERM+7, TTERM+8, TTERM+9 |
TERMIEN | TERM+2~, TTERM+3*, TTERM+4, TTERM+5 |
TEXT | DOREM+4~, DOREM+88*, DOREM+89*, DOREM+90, DOREM+113*, DOREM+115 |
TEXTOUT | DOREM+4~, DOREM+37, DOREM+48 |
TEXTOUT( | DOREM+38, DOREM+50 |
TFIEVAL | DOREM+4~, DOREM+64! |
TFIEVAL( | DOREM+64* |
TTEXT | DOREM+4~, DOREM+17*, DOREM+18, DOREM+19, DOREM+66!, DOREM+76!, DOREM+97!, DOREM+107! |
TTEXT( | DOREM+35, DOREM+36, DOREM+37, DOREM+69, DOREM+81, DOREM+100, DOREM+110 |
U | GPAT1+3, GREM1+3, GREM1+5, GPAT2+3, GREM2+3, DISP01+9, DISP01+10, DISP01+11, DOREM+18, DOREM+19 , DOREM+48, DOREM+122, TPAT+3, TTERM+3, TTERM+8, TTERM+9, TTERM+11 |
VAEL | DOREM+74~, DOREM+75* |
WEND | DOREM+4~, DOREM+13*, DOREM+23 |
WSTART | DOREM+4~, DOREM+7*, DOREM+23 |
X | DEB+2~, GREM1+10*, GREM1+11, DEV+2~, DOREM+4~, DOREM+133* |
Y | DEB+2~, GPAT1+3, GREM1+3, GREM1+20, DEV+2~, GPAT2+3, GREM2+3, GREM2+14, TPAT+3, TTERM+3 |